Winter Favorites in Northern Pakistan

Northern areas are the best destination throughout the month of December because of snowfall, ice lakes and winter sports. Hunza Valley is characterized by snow covered mountains, blue skies and winter festivals. With frozen lakes and beautiful landscapes, Skardu, being the access point to great mountain ranges, is perfect in photography. A popular skiing and snow adventure destination in Malam Jabba during the winter season makes Swat Valley a mini Switzerland of Pakistan.

Murree remains the most convenient winter hill station among families and Naran and Kaghan remain popular among those who want to have a snowy adventure that is not so crowded. Nevertheless, road and weather conditions should be checked by travelers before they go to high altitudes. To make winter tourism in the north of the country safer, in December 2025, the government reinforced the rescue services and roads maintenance.

Cultural Cities and Coastal Escapes

Decision making It is not always snow that is there in December. Lahore, Islamabad, and Multan have a mild winter climate that is ideal in exploration of heritage, food festivals and cultural tourism. Lahore is a seasonal place due to its winter food streets, literature festivals and Mughal architecture.

Close to the shores, Gwadar and Karachi are good destinations with good temperatures that are conducive to beach trips. The serene beaches, new resorts, and the sunset in Gwadar have elevated the place to an up-and-coming winter resort. Karachi, on the other hand, is a good place to be during year-end celebrations, festivals and recreation along the sea side, thus making it a lively place to spend holidays in December.
